Output 3c3ec131c7828869b5982909aec7e389429796cea36202f9942b746c65198ab4:13

value
15706918
script pubkey
OP_0 OP_PUSHBYTES_32 d570b6df628a7a7babeec415043264d53cb4c479f6c5439f4bfa30115f99ae08
address
bc1q64ctdhmz3fa8h2lwcs2sgvny657tf3re7mz5886tlgcpzhue4cyqz0j3hm
transaction
3c3ec131c7828869b5982909aec7e389429796cea36202f9942b746c65198ab4
spent
true